Default Add editable field for amounts of Volume/pan in Media Item properties

Request:
Please make it editable field for amounts of Volume/pan in Media Item properties. See attach

Benefit:
Sometimes need to set 'Volume' of Media Item to '-6.00dB'. For this simple operation in Media Item properties used slider. The accuracy in this case is very low, even if use CTRL key. Example amounts of slider may be
shifted between '-6.05dB' and '-5.93dB', and never set to '-6.00dB'

Excellent suggestion.

Generally speaking in interface design wherever a numerical input is possible best practice is to have the option to enter a value both directly as a number or with whatever graphic element is provided (slider / knob). This should be consistent across the interface

There are other areas of the interface that could do with a bit of tidying up as well - eg the wet/dry mix knob in the FX window does not allow numerical input (i think)
